The best tre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4 approach depends on the specific type of lung cancer, genetic mutations, overall health, and individual preferences.Understanding Stage 4 Lung CancerStage 4 lung cancer signifies that the disease has metastasized, meaning it has spread beyond the lungs to other areas of the body. Common sites of metastasis include the brain, bones, liver, and adrenal glands. It's crucial to accurately identify the type of lung cancer (non-small cell lung cancer or small cell lung cancer) and any specific genetic mutations, as this information significantly impacts tre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4 decisions.Types of Lung CancerThe two main types of lung cancer are: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er (NSCLC): The most common type, accounting for about 80-85% of lung cancer cases. Subtypes include adenocarcinoma, squamous cell carcinoma, and large cell carcinoma. Small Cell Lung Cancer (SCLC): A more aggressive type of lung cancer that tends to spread quickly. It's often associated with smoking.Importance of Genetic TestingGenetic testing, also known as biomarker testing, is essential for patients with NSCLC. It identifies specific mutations in the cancer cells that can be targeted with specific tre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4. Common mutations include EGFR, ALK, ROS1, BRAF, and PD-L1. Identifying these mutations opens the door to personalized medicine.Treatment New Treatments for Lung Cancer Stage 4 OptionsSeveral tre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4 are available for stage 4 lung cancer, often used in combination:Targeted TherapyTargeted therapy drugs specifically target cancer cells with particular genetic mutations, minimizing damage to healthy cells. These therapies are often administered orally. EGFR Inhibitors: Used for NSCLC patients with EGFR mutations. Examples include erlotinib, gefitinib, afatinib, and osimertinib. Osimertinib is often used as a first-line tre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4. ALK Inhibitors: Used for NSCLC patients with ALK rearrangements. Examples include crizotinib, alectinib, ceritinib, brigatinib, and lorlatinib. ROS1 Inhibitors: Used for NSCLC patients with ROS1 rearrangements. Examples include crizotinib and entrectinib. BRAF Inhibitors: Used for NSCLC patients with BRAF V600E mutations. You may also find valuable information on resources like the American Cancer Society website.ImmunotherapyImmunotherapy drugs help the body's immune system recognize and attack cancer cells. They work by blocking proteins that prevent the immune system from attacking cancer cells. PD-1/PD-L1 Inhibitors: These drugs block the PD-1/PD-L1 pathway, which helps cancer cells evade the immune system. Examples include pembrolizumab, nivolumab, atezolizumab, and durvalumab. Pembrolizumab is sometimes used as a first-line tre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4 for patients with high PD-L1 expression. CTLA-4 Inhibitors: These drugs block the CTLA-4 protein, which also helps regulate the immune system. Ipilimumab is an example. Immunotherapy has shown significant promise in improving outcomes for some patients with stage 4 lung cancer. It is often used in combination with other tre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4. Platinum-based Chemotherapy: Commonly used chemotherapy regimens include cisplatin or carboplatin combined with other drugs like pemetrexed, gemcitabine, or taxanes.Radiation TherapyRadiation therapy uses high-energy rays to kill cancer cells. It can be used to shrink tumors, relieve symptoms, and improve quality of life. External Beam Radiation Therapy: Delivers radiation from a machine outside the body. Stereotactic Body Radiation Therapy (SBRT): A precise type of radiation therapy that delivers high doses of radiation to a small area.SurgerySurgery is typically not a primary tre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4 option, but it may be considered in specific cases to remove a single metastasis or to alleviate symptoms.Supportive CareSupportive care focuses on managing symptoms and side effects of cancer and its tre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4. It includes pain management, nutritional support, and psychological support.Clinical TrialsClinical trials are research studies that evaluate new treatment new treatments for lung cancer stage 4.
